A comforting, hearty stew with chicken, corn, plantains, and root vegetables. Any protein works. Use what you've got. It's a one-pot soul-warmer. Upon researching this one I found that the Dominican Republic, Panama, Colombia, Puerto Rico and Venezuela all have a version!

Recipe

Ingredients

·1 lb chicken pieces
·1 plantain, sliced
·1 ear of corn, cut into chunks
·1 cassava root (yuca), chopped (can sub tarro root)
·4 cups chicken broth
·1 tbsp sofrito (homemade or from the jar works too)

Directions

1.Brown the chicken in a large pot.
2.Add sofrito, broth, corn, plantain, and cassava.
3.Simmer for 30-40 minutes until vegetables are tender and the broth is thickened.
